Biography of Kourtney Kardashian
Kourtney Mary Kardashian, born on April 18, 1979, is an Armenian-American socialite, model, businesswoman, and television personality. She is best known for her appearances on the reality shows "Keeping Up with the Kardashians" and "Kourtney and Khloe Take Miami".

Early Life
Kourtney Kardashian was born in Los Angeles to attorney Robert Kardashian and his wife Kris Jenner Kardashian. Her father, of Armenian descent, was famously known for being one of O.J. Simpson's lawyers during his high-profile trial. Kourtney's mother is of Dutch and Scottish descent.

Education
Kourtney attended Marymount High School, a Catholic girls' school. After graduating, she spent two years at Southern Methodist University in Dallas. She then transferred to the University of Arizona in Tucson, where she completed her degree in Theater Arts with a minor in Spanish. During her time at the university, Kourtney studied alongside future stars Nicole Richie, Heather Blair, and Luke Walton.

Career
After graduating from university, Kourtney and her mother opened a children's clothing boutique called "Smooch" with locations in Los Angeles and New York. She is also a co-owner and manager of the Los Angeles boutique clothing chain "D-A-S-H", as seen on the show "Keeping Up with the Kardashians". In 2009, Kourtney, along with her sisters Khloe and Kim, opened a "D-A-S-H" store in Miami, which was featured on their reality show "Kourtney and Khloe Take Miami".
Kourtney has appeared in several television projects, including the charity reality show "Filthy Rich: Cattle Drive" in 2005.
